Chandelier Creative and Commonwealth Fashion Week Diner

I really like the attention to details in the curation of the table setting for this intimate dinner at the New Musem on February 14th – hosted by Richard Christiansen of Chandelier Creative. To celebrate Fashion Week and Commonwealth Utilities

Guests were treated to gold lacquered army tables and antique candelabras, as well as 150 gold tanks and 1500 gold soldiers. Love letters from soldiers in WW1 and WW2 were placed on everyone’s chair with stunning views of lower Manhattan providing the scenery. (I want to see those love letters!!) Among the attendees: Richard Christiansen, Lorenzo Martone, Peter Som, Lane Crawford’s Jennifer Woo, Steve Madden.
